Abstract:
In the paper, a dynamic model of diffusion of genetically modified crop technology is developed and simulated using the U.S. soybean market data. The model accounts for factors specific to agricultural markets, such as oligopsony power and strategic interaction among crop processors, growers' characteristics such as adoption behavior, and identity preservation requirements. Simulation results show how these factors affect the magnitude and distribution of the potential gains from genetically modified crops.
